Ancillary Deadline Draws Near For Barbecue And Steak Competitors

The World Food Championships’ (WFC) Barbecue and Steak competitors have extra opportunities to rack up prize money outside of its 8th annual Main Event in Dallas, Texas. This October, thanks to several great Food Sport sponsors, competitors can sign up for several ancillary challenges. However, with the deadline for sign-ups (Sunday, September 1) quickly approaching, cooks interested in earning some additional cash need to register now before it's too late!

Ancillaries such as the Cattle Dog Coffee and Bolner’s Fiesta Seasoning challenges are exclusive to the Barbecue category, whereas the highly sought after SteakOut People’s Choice event is only offered to Steak competitors. 

Check out the details for each ancillary below.

Cattle Dog Coffee – Thursday, October 17th – Barbecue Zone

Up to 40 Barbecue competitors can participate in this challenge. Competitors are required to provide their own protein. Cattle Dog Coffee will provide 12 oz. of Guatemala Whole Bean coffees of both light and dark roast coffees for competitors to use for this ancillary. Competitors interested in this ancillary should arrive at the Barbecue Zone at 9 a.m. Turn in begins at noon. 

  • 1st Place = $300

  • 2nd Place = $200

  • 3rd Place = $100

Bolner’s Fiesta Seasoning – Thursday, October 17th – Barbecue Zone

Up to 40 Barbecue competitors can participate in this challenge. Competitors are permitted to use any protein of their choice for this challenge. They must season the protein with any combination of Bolner’s Fiesta Seasonings, which will be provided in the following flavors: Ground Comino, Crushed Red Pepper, and Cinnamon Sticks. Competitors interested in this ancillary should arrive at the Barbecue Zone at 9 a.m. Turn in begins at 1 p.m.

  • 1st Place = $300

  • 2nd Place = $200

  • 3rd Place = $100

SteakOut People’s Choice – Saturday, October 19th – SteakOut Zone

Up to 20 Steak teams can sign up to be part of this fun sampling event. Steaks will be provided to teams by Hassell Cattle Company. Teams will grill up samples and serve to the public for approximately 1.5 hours. The team that collects the most tokens will take first place!

  • 1st Place = $500

  • 2nd Place = $300

  • 3rd Place = $200

About the World Food Championships

The World Food Championships (WFC) is the highest stakes food competition in the world. This multi-day, live-event culinary competition showcases some of the world's best cooking masters competing for food, fame and fortune in ten categories: Bacon, Barbecue, Burger, Chef, Chili, Dessert, Recipe, Sandwich, Seafood and Steak. In 2018, over 1,500 contestants on nearly 500 official teams from 42 American states and 12 countries competed. More than 20 million people have attended WFC or have seen it on national TV over the past seven years. This year's Main Event will be held in Dallas, Texas at Reunion Tower Lawn, Oct. 16-20.
